I have found 3 websites all with different names leading to John at Cozumel cruise exercusions dot net

 

A Pennsylvania phone number that does not accept voice messages, same address in Coz and my paypal receipt with his business name on it.

 

I have contacted numerous other tour operators for my upcoming December South Caribbean cruise and at most have waited 2 days for a reply.

 

I sent him a deposit and no confirmation nor receipt was sent to me when he finally contacted me he was claiming he only takes reservations for this other person tour operator but that it isn't him.

 

So I asked him for this other person's name and phone number and he has yet to send it.

 

It took over a week for him to respond to me only because I posted on FB.

 

I just want my money back.

 

I will be in Cozumel at the end of the month and I will book my own tour at Playa Palancar which the destination experts and other frequent visitors say is easy to do and not to bother booking online.

After reading the bad reviews just be also afraid that when we get to Cozumel nobody would be there, so we planned a “plan B”. Everything was ok. Carla wait for us and driven to the place of embarkation exactly as directed on recipes that comes automatically when we made the advance payment. The staff is friendly, the drinks are enough and the food is delicious. We saw a sea turtle and interesting fishes and beautiful azure water that changed dozens of shades depending on our route. I find this company good but things can always be better. One weakness is that the boat was old, easy little slow but the staff made us forget the low speed and the fuel smell who came from time to time. The places where we were taken are wonderful and I think that 80 $ are an excellent price. I will select a second time the company. If you want a respond more quickly use FB messages company.

NB meeting is established reported by local time and it is usually an hour after the ship time.

Our ship arrived in port at 8:00 am and our tour departed at 9am. They will send you very detailed instructions as to where you are to meet them depending on which port you arrive at. It was a very short walk and Cozumel is so beautiful that we didn't mind. We never felt unsafe and their directions were spot on. We returned to the same location we had previously met at that morning, I would say between 3 and 3:30 pm. We had plenty of time to shop! Hope y'all have an awesome adventure!!
